Fondazione Giorgio Cini - Studi di musica veneta - Archivio Alfredo Casella In questa ristampa commentata della antologia di scritti critici di Alfredo Casella (?21+26?, Roma, Augustea 1930) sono illustrate le posizioni critiche del compositore negli anni cruciali dell?avanguardia artistica italiana. Il volume contiene diversi profili di musicisti, ricordi di viaggi a fondo culturale, polemiche e alcuni saggi di poetica e tecnica compositiva. This commented reprint of the anthology of Alfredo Casella?s writings (?21+26?, Roma, Augustea 1930) illustrates the critical positions of the composer in the crucial years of Italian avantgarde, in the twenties. The volume contains various profiles of musicians, memories of cultural travels, controversies on jazz, musical nationalism, musical folklore, modernity and a few texts on poetry and composition techniques. 349 gr. x-142 p.

Biblioteca dell'?Archivum Romanicum? - Serie I: Storia, Letteratura, Paleografia Ricerche d?archivio permettono di collocare nel 1563 la nascita della famosa cantatrice e arpista Laura Peperara, cancellando l?ipotesi di Solerti che in quel tempo ella sia stata la ?seconda fiamma? del Tasso, destinataria di un canzoniere amoroso; ? cos? possibile ricostruire sotto una diversa angolatura la vicenda artistica della Peperara, e riordinare un importante settore della produzione lirica tassiana. Archival research allows us to establish that Laura Peperara, famous singer and harp player, was born in 1563. This eliminates Solerti?s hypothesis that she was Tasso?s second love interest at the time, as well as the receiver of a book of love poems. Consequently, it is possible to reconstruct Peperara?s artistic path from a different angle and reorganize an important part of Tasso?s lyrical production. A CD entitled ?Madrigali per Laura Peperara? accompanies the volume. 692 gr. vi-352 p.

cm. 18 x 25,5, x-258 pp. Studi e testi per la storia della musica Viene proposta l?edizione critica del libretto di Felice Romani per Giovanni Simone Mayr. Un ampio saggio introduttivo racconta le vicende dell?opera dalla commissione del San Carlo di Napoli (1813) al successo internazionale dovuto all?interpretazione di Giuditta Pasta; studia inoltre le scelte metriche e poetiche di Romani sullo sfondo della tradizione drammatica, coreutica e lirica del mito di Medea in Corinto in Italia. Critical edition of Felice Romani?s libretto for Johann Simon Mayr, with an extensive introductory essay describing the history of this opera commissioned in 1813 by the Teatro di San Carlo of Naples, and its great international success, which was due to Giuditta Pasta?s interpretation. Russo also describes the dramatic, lyrical and choreographic tradition of the the myth of Medea in Corinto in Italy and how this influenced Romani?s metrical and poetical choices. 525 gr. x-258 p.
cm. 17 x 24, x-216 pp. con 16 tavv. f.t. colori. Historiae Musicae Cultores - Biblioteca Il volume esamina i codici musicali appartenuti ai monasteri domenicani femminili di S. Agnese e S. Maria Maddalena di Val di Pietra in Bologna. Si tratta di una trentina di manoscritti riccamente miniati, prodotti tra i secoli XIII e XVI, espressione della committenza di illustri famiglie bolognesi. Il catalogo con la descrizione dei codici ? preceduto da un?introduzione che riferisce circa la ricostruzione della dotazione libraria dei due monasteri ed esamina i canti di nuova produzione, in stretta connessione con il culto di particolari santi. This book explores the musical codices from the Dominican convents of Saint Agnes and Saint Mary Magdalen of Valdipietra in Bologna. There are about thirty large richly illuminated manuscripts produced between the 13th and 16th centuries, commissioned by noble Bolognese families. The catalogue describing the codices is preceded by an introduction that traces the provenance of these choir books and examines the connection between the new Gregorian chants created by the nuns and the worship of particular saints. 474 gr. x-216 p.
cm. 18 x 25,5, 286 pp. Historiae Musicae Cultores - Biblioteca Prendendo le mosse dall?Alto Medioevo, ecco la prima volta un?indagine sistematica sui ?Pueri cantus? nelle scuole cattedrali d?Italia di grammatica e di musica, riportate in auge da papa Eugenio IV tra il 1435 e il 1446, che dettero un impulso decisivo alla costituzione delle nascenti cappelle musicali, costituendone spesso il nucleo embrionale. Starting from the Early Middle Ages this is the first systematic investigation of the 'Pueri cantus' in Italian cathedral schools of grammar and music which found favour with Pope Eugene IV between 1435 and 1446 boosting the constitution of new music chapels, often becoming the embryonic nucleus. 580 gr. 286 p.
